Rockwell Automation and NEO Battery Materials to collaborate on automation of new 240-ton silicon anode facility in North America
Rockwell Automation, Inc. is working with Toronto, Ontario-based silicon anode active materials company, NEO Battery Materials. The collaboration aims to deliver solutions to aid the battery material manufacturer on its first North American facility, a 240-ton facility with the capacity to grow up to 5,000 tons of silicon anode material per year in Windsor, Ontario.
